Modeling Viral Evolution

Learn and predict the zoonotic evolution of viruses with the goal of preparing for the emergence of new pathogens. Build computational models to predict the mutations that enable an animal virus to shift hosts and adapt to human cells. Predictive Models of Long COVID

Prediction of the poorly understood post-acute sequelae of SARS-CoV-2 infection (PASC, or long COVID) based on information derived from the electronic health records (EHRs) of acute COVID-19 infection available in the National COVID Cohort Collaborative — the largest harmonized repository of EHRs of COVID-19 patients in the US.

Aarogya – An Intelligent Multi-Agent Pediatric System

An intelligent system offering pediatric services to counter the infant mortality rate caused by the unavailability of pediatricians in rural India. The project was funded by the Department of Science and Technology, Government of India through the Innovation and Entrepreneurship Development Center at Fr.Conceicao Rodrigues College of Engineering.
